Immediate Activity Tips



To properly resolve a parasite invasion, take immediate action steps to have and remove the issue swiftly. The initial crucial action is to recognize the source of the infestation. Check your home extensively to situate where the parasites are going into or nesting. Seal any cracks, gaps, or openings that could be possible entry points. Get rid of any mess or debris where parasites can hide or reproduce.

Next, eliminate feasible food and water resources that may be bring in bugs. Store food in closed containers, without delay tidy up spills, and deal with any leaking pipes or taps. Usage catches or baits to record bugs already present in your house. Bear in mind the significance of following safety preventative measures when making use of chemicals or traps.

Frequently clean and sanitize your space to hinder bugs from returning. Take into consideration making use of all-natural repellents like pepper mint oil or vinegar to maintain bugs away. Keep in mind, taking quick activity is vital to stop the pest problem from getting worse.
